Photo taken on July 27, 2022 shows lotus flowers in Baiyangdian Lake in Xiongan New Area, north China's Hebei Province. Baiyangdian Lake, the largest wetland ecosystem in northern China, has seen significant improvement in its water quality thanks to environmental protection and restoration efforts in recent years. (Xinhua/Zhu Xudong)
